Determination of Chlorogenic Acid in Sangjiangganmao Capsules by RP-HPLC

Objective: To establish a RP-HPLC method for the determination of chlorogenic acid in Sangjiangganmao capsules.
Methods: An Agela XBP-C18 (250 mm×4.6 mm, 5 μm) column was applied, the mobile phase was acetonitrile-0.4% phosphoric (9:91), the detection wavelength was 327 nm with the flow rate of 0.1mL/min. Results: There was a good linear relationship in the chlorogenic acid concentration range of 0.02-0.25 μg (r=0.999 8). The average recovery was 99.5%, RSD=0.67% (n=6). Conclusion: The method was with good repeatability, flexibility and high sensitivity, which can be used in the quality control of Sangjiangganmao capsules.
